  • bluebird
    bluebird
    ✭✭✭✭✭
    ✭✭✭
    You can only get 2 Tickets per day, but you have some choice where you get those two from. :smile:

    You can get 1 Ticket from Elsweyr only
    - either kill a Northern Elsweyr dragon
    - or kill the last boss of Sunspire

    You can get 1 Ticket from any of the other DLCs (Wrathstone or Scalebreaker or Dragonhold)
    - either kill a Southern Elsweyr dragon
    - or kill the last boss in Frostvault, Depths of Malatar, Moongrave Fane, or Lair of Maarselok.
